melody. promoting The Best of melody. ~Timeline~ (2008)

melody. is a Japanese urban pop artist. She made her debut in early 2003 with the single "Dreamin' Away", but wasn't majorly recognized until later that year when she became a part of m-flo's "loves..." project. Since then, most of her releases have charted within the top twenty on the Oricon charts. On October 22, 2008, melody. announced that she will retire from the music industry in January 2009 and plans to enter the fashion industry as a designer of Western-styled clothes.

In March 2009, melody. announced her pregnancy and marriage with visual kei artist Miyavi.They have two daughters, "Lovelie Miyavi Ishihara" (born July 29, 2009) and "Jewelie Aoi Ishihara" (born October 21, 2010).

Trivia

  • Her fanclub was called "Ohana" which means "family" in Hawaiian.
  • Played the character Yumi Yamamoto in Electronic Art's Need for Speed: Carbon.
  • From April 2007 until October 2008, she was the host of NHK World's all-English weekly music show, J-MELO.
  • Both of her parents lived in Hawaii before meeting each other. Her father was a musician from Tokyo while her mother came from Okinawa.
  • Her sister, Christine, goes by the name KURIS in the Japanese music industry and has contributed her songwriting and musical skills to a number of melody.'s songs.
